Federal housing official submitted Schiff criminal referral to DOJ over mortgage documents

Context:

Senator Adam Schiff has been referred to the Department of Justice for alleged mortgage fraud involving false statements to secure better loan terms on properties in Maryland and California. The Federal Housing Finance Agency's director, William Pulte, accused Schiff of falsifying documents to claim a Potomac, Maryland property as his primary residence, despite representing California in Congress. This misrepresentation allowed Schiff to benefit from lower interest rates typically reserved for primary residences. President Trump has publicly called for Schiff's prosecution, labeling him a 'scam artist' and accusing him of serious mortgage fraud. Schiff, who has faced previous accusations from Trump, responded by dismissing the claims as baseless and politically motivated attacks on the rule of law.

Dive Deeper:

  • Senator Adam Schiff is accused of falsifying bank documents and property records to acquire favorable loan terms for a property in Potomac, Maryland, which he claimed was his primary residence despite his role as a California representative.

  • The Federal Housing Finance Agency's director, William Pulte, highlighted the risks such alleged misconduct poses to the stability of the U.S. mortgage market and called for the DOJ's involvement, citing potential violations of federal criminal codes.

  • Schiff and his wife did not list their Maryland home as a secondary residence until 2020, while simultaneously claiming a homeowner's tax exemption on a California condo, suggesting dual claims of primary residency.

  • President Donald Trump has taken to social media to demand Schiff's accountability, accusing him of a pattern of mortgage fraud and emphasizing the seriousness of the allegations.

  • In response, Schiff has released a statement asserting that the accusations are part of a continued political vendetta by Trump, characterizing them as baseless and an attack on the rule of law, while drawing parallels to previous unsubstantiated claims made by Trump against him.
